Show simple item record

dc.contributor.advisorBilgen, Semih
dc.contributor.advisorErten, Yusuf Murat
dc.contributor.authorYilmaz Taştekin, Semra
dc.date.accessioned2020-12-10T09:14:00Z
dc.date.available2020-12-10T09:14:00Z
dc.date.submitted2013
dc.date.issued2018-08-06
dc.identifier.urihttps://acikbilim.yok.gov.tr/handle/20.500.12812/225459
dc.description.abstractGeliştirme süresi kestirimi proje yönetimi açısından özellikle yazılım içerikli sistem projelerinde çok önemli bir husus olarak değerlendirilmektedir. Proje başlamadan önce ürünün geliştirme detayına yönelik çok fazla bilgi mevcut olmamaktadır. Bundan dolayı, geliştirme süresi doğru bir şekilde tahmin edilemeyebilir. Aynı alanda bulunan eski projeler var ise, bu projelerdeki veriler yeni projelerde kullanılabilmektedir. Projenin başında gereksinimler belirlenmekte ve gereksinim özellikleri dokümanı hazırlanmaktadır. Önceki projelerden kullanılan gereksinimlerin belirlenmesiyle benzerlik analizi yapılabilmekte ve bu analiz, geliştirme süresi kestirimi yapılmasında kullanılabilmektedir. Bu tezde, daha önceden proje yönetimi kapsamında önerilen bir modelin, yazılım içerikli geliştirme projelerinde uygulanabilirliği çalışılmıştır. Bu kapsamda, aynı alanda bulunan farklı ürünler için gereksinimlerin tekrar kullanılmasıyla ürünlerin geliştirme süresine etkisi çalışılmıştır. Aynı alandaki farklı ürünler için benzerlik analizi yapılmış ve bu analizin sonuçları geliştirme süresi kestiriminde kullanılmıştır. Geliştirme süresi kestirimi için Griffin tarafından önerilen ürün geliştirme süresi modeli [9] kullanılmıştır. Griffin tarafından önerilen modelin endüstriyel organizasyonlarda uygulanabilirliğine yönelik olarak dokuz adet deneysel çalışma yapılmıştır. Bu deneysel çalışmanın kapsamında yazılım projeleri ve yazılım ve donanım ürünleri içeren sistem projeleri değerlendirilmiştir. Bu çalışmalardan elde edilen sonuçlar, Griffin tarafından önerilen model ile karşılaştırılmıştır. Firmalardan elde edilen verilere göre, Griffin tarafından önerilen ürün geliştirme süresine ilişkin formülasyona, yazılım projelerine yönelik olarak bir modifikasyon önerilmiştir. Sadece yazılım içerikli veya yazılım ve donanım içerikli projelerde, önerilen model, proje yöneticilerinin projeyi daha doğru bütçelenmesinde yardımcı olacaktır.Anahtar Kelimeler: Ürün geliştirme süresi, gereksinimlerin tekrar kullanılmasına dayalı ürün benzerliği
dc.description.abstractAccurate development time estimation is crucial for project management in general, and critical for software intensive systems projects, in particular. Before beginning the project, little information is available for development details. Therefore, development time may not be estimated correctly. If data on previous projects in the same domain is available, this can be used for development time estimations. At the beginning of the project, requirements are defined and requirements specification document is created as a formal document in the organizations. By using the reused requirements from previous projects, a similarity analysis can be performed and this analysis can be used for development time estimation. This study investigates the applicability of a model that was proposed earlier for project management in general, in software intensive systems development projects. In this scope, the impact of requirements reuse on product development duration for different products in a similar domain is studied. Similarity analysis has been performed for different products in the same domain and the result of this analysis is used to estimate the development time. For development time estimation, Griffin?s model [9] is used. For the applicability of Griffin?s model for industrial companies, nine case studies from different organizations have been performed for software and system development projects which consist of hardware and software components. The results of the case studies are compared with Griffins model. According to the empirical results, a modification to Griffin?s formulation for product development time is proposed for software projects. For the projects which include only software or both software and hardware, the proposed model will guide project managers to estimate project budgets more accurately.Keywords: Product development time, product similarity based on requirements reuseen_US
dc.languageEnglish
dc.language.isoen
dc.rightsinfo:eu-repo/semantics/openAccess
dc.rightsAttribution 4.0 United Statestr_TR
dc.rights.urihttps://creativecommons.org/licenses/by/4.0/
dc.subjectBil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ontroltr_TR
dc.subjectComputer Engineering and Computer Science and Controlen_US
dc.titleUse of project similarity for software development time estimation
dc.title.alternativeYazılım geliştirme süresi kestiriminde proje benzerliğinin kullanılması
dc.typedoctoralThesis
dc.date.updated2018-08-06
dc.contributor.departmentBilişim Sistemleri Anabilim Dalı
dc.identifier.yokid10017450
dc.publisher.instituteEnformatik Enstitüsü
dc.publisher.universityORTA DOĞU TEKNİK ÜNİVERSİTESİ
dc.identifier.thesisid343094
dc.description.pages168
dc.publisher.disciplineDiğer


Files in this item

Thumbnail

This item appears in the following Collection(s)

Show simple item record

info:eu-repo/semantics/openAccess
Except where otherwise noted, this item's license is described as info:eu-repo/semantics/openAccess